Normal forms for general polynomial matrices
We present an algorithm for the computation of a shifted Popov Normal Form of a rectangular polynomial matrix. For specific input shifts, we obtain methods for computing the matrix greatest common divisor of two matrix polynomials (in normal form) or such polynomial normal form computation as the classical Popov form and the Hermite Normal Form. متن کاملComputing Jordan Normal Forms Exactly for Commuting Matrices in Polynomial Time
We prove that the Jordan Normal Form of a rational matrix can be computed exactly in polynomial time. We obtain the transformation matrix and its inverse exactly, and we show how to apply the basis transformation to any commuting matrices.

متن کاملDynamic Normal Forms and Dynamic Characteristic Polynomial
We present the first fully dynamic algorithm for computing the characteristic polynomial of a matrix. In the generic symmetric case our algorithm supports rank-one updates in O(n log n) randomized time and queries in constant time, whereas in the general case the algorithm works in O(nk log n) randomized time, where k is the number of invariant factors of the matrix.
